Common Causes Of Amana Hotel Air Conditioner Not Cooling

Several factors can prevent an Amana hotel air conditioner from delivering cold air. Understanding the root cause helps choose the right fix and avoid unnecessary parts replacement.

  • <strongInsufficient Refrigerant: Low refrigerant due to leaks reduces cooling capacity and can cause the system to struggle, especially on hot days.
  • <strongClogged Air Filters Or Ducts: Restricted airflow reduces cooling efficiency and can trigger the system to cycle frequently without achieving desired temperatures.
  • <strongThermostat Setpoint Or Sensor Issues: Incorrect or malfunctioning thermostats can misread room temperature, preventing proper cooling.
  • <strongCondenser Unit Obstruction: Debris, foliage, or dirt around the outdoor condenser impedes heat exchange.
  • <strongElectrical Or Capacitor Problems: Faulty capacitors, contactors, or wiring can prevent the compressor or fans from starting or running correctly.
  • <strongFrozen Evaporator Coil: Excess humidity or airflow problems can freeze the evaporator, blocking cooling airflow.
  • <strongDrainage Or Condensate Blockages: Blocked condensate lines can trigger safety switches that interrupt operation.

Quick Diagnostic Steps

For a rapid assessment, follow these non-invasive checks before calling a technician. Always prioritize safety and power down the unit when inspecting electrical components.

  • Check Thermostat Settings: Verify temperature setpoint and mode (cooling) are correct. Compare room temperature with the thermostat reading.
  • <strongInspect Air Filters: If dirty or clogged, replace or clean filters to restore airflow.
  • <strongExamine Outdoor Condenser: Clear debris around the unit and ensure it has at least 2 feet of clearance on all sides.
  • <strongListen For Unusual Noises: Squealing or grinding sounds can indicate mechanical or bearing issues requiring professional service.
  • <strongLook For Ice Or Frost On Coils: If coils are frozen, turn system off for a few hours to thaw and investigate potential airflow or refrigerant problems.
  • <strongCheck Circuit Breakers: Ensure the outdoor unit and indoor components have power, and reset tripped breakers if needed.

Repair And Maintenance Solutions

Addressing the root cause often involves a mix of maintenance tasks and selective part replacements. The following guidelines help keep Amana hotel systems reliable and energy-efficient.

  • <strongReplace Or Clean Filters Regularly: For high-occupancy environments, establish a monthly filter inspection schedule and replace filters as needed.
  • <strongClean Ducts And Vents: Periodic professional duct cleaning reduces airflow restrictions and improves cooling performance.
  • <strongInspect And Clean Condenser Coil: A dirty coil lowers efficiency; carefully remove debris and wash with a gentle coil cleaner or water stream.
  • <strongCheck Refrigerant For Leaks: If cooling performance is poor with proper airflow, a refrigerant leak may be present. Trained technicians must handle refrigerant charging and leak repair.
  • <strongTest Electrical Components: Inspect capacitors, contactors, relays, and wiring for signs of wear, burning odor, or voltage irregularities; replace defective parts.
  • <strongThorough System Calibration: Ensure temperature sensors, controls, and zoning thermostats are calibrated for consistent cooling across zones.
  • <strongManage Humidity: In humid environments, optimize dehumidification by adjusting fan speed and vent settings to prevent coil icing and improve comfort.

When To Call A Technician

While many basic issues can be addressed onsite, certain conditions require professional service to avoid further damage and ensure guest safety.

  • <strongPersistent Non-Cooling: If the system runs but never reaches the set temperature even after cleaning filters and checking power.
  • <strongRefrigerant Suspected Or Leaks Detected: Handling refrigerant requires licensed technicians with proper recovery equipment.
  • <strongElectrical Problems Or Burning Smell: Any signs of burnt components or electrical arcing demand immediate professional intervention.
  • <strongFrequent Breaker Trips: Recurrent tripping indicates electrical issues that could pose safety risks.
  • <strongCompressor Or Fan Failures: Unresponsive or noisy compressors and fans typically require replacement or major repairs by technicians.
